UW SYSTEM PLACEMENT TESTING

Most University of Wisconsin System campuses require students to take placement tests. The majority of students will take the exams the spring before their freshman year during the Regional Testing Program. UW Oshkosh CAPP REQUIRED MATH PLACEMENT

Any student who wishes to take a CAPP math class and gain college credit through MPTC or UW-O (College Algebra, Pre-Calculus, Calculus, Calculus 2 and AP Stats), must pass a placement exam per the University of Wisconsin System requirement. This is a UW System requirement. You will not be able to gain college credit through UW-Oshkosh without this placement exam, unless you have already successfully completed a college math course. If you are unsure, it is our recommendation that you take the placement exam. The placement exam is typically given during late March.

If your child typically receives accommodations for testing, please contact your case manager by early March (accommodations have to be requested by the student through the case manager, in the same process of the UW placement exam). *For exact date refer to permission slip.

ALL students in Algebra II will receive a permission slip from their math teacher as well as any student in subsequent courses who have not previously enrolled in a dual credit math course.
